There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Wamego is 15.6% cheaper than Mission. With a cost index of 78 vs 90,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Wamego to Mission should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Mission is $1,181/month compared to $1,032/month in Wamego — a 14%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Wamego is more affordable at $187,700 median vs $268,500.

Median household income in Mission is $74,396 compared to $82,756 in Wamego (-10.1%). Wamego off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Mission spend roughly 19% of their income on rent, more than the 15% in Wamego.
